Bridal Fashion on a Budget
Bridal fashion is perhaps one of the most exciting and daunting aspects of wedding planning. Every bride dreams of walking down the aisle in a gown that makes her feel like royalty. However, the cost of a wedding dress can be a significant portion of the wedding budget. Fortunately, there are numerous ways to find a stunning dress without overspending.
Consider shopping at bridal sample sales, where designer dresses are sold at a fraction of their original cost. Online retailers and consignment stores also offer a wide range of budget-friendly options. Renting a wedding dress is another trend that's gaining popularity, allowing brides to wear high-end designs for a day at a lower cost.
Custom-made dresses by local designers can also provide a unique and affordable option. Additionally, consider non-traditional dresses or gowns from evening wear collections, which can be less expensive than traditional bridal wear but equally elegant.
Remember, the key is to start your search early, try on various styles, and be open to alternatives you might not have considered initially. With patience and persistence, you'll find a dress that suits both your taste and budget.
How Can You Save on the Wedding Venue?
The wedding venue sets the stage for your big day, but it doesn't have to be the most expensive aspect. To save on the venue, consider having your wedding during the off-peak season or on a weekday, as many venues offer discounts during these times.
Outdoor venues such as parks or beaches can also be cost-effective, often requiring just a permit fee. Hosting the ceremony and reception at the same location can cut transportation and decoration costs significantly.

Look for venues that offer inclusive packages, which can provide significant savings on catering, decorations, and rentals. Finally, think about unconventional spaces like community halls or art galleries, which can be both affordable and memorable.
DIY Decorations and Crafts
Creating your own decorations can be a cost-effective way to add a personal touch to your wedding. DIY projects not only save money but also offer an opportunity for creativity and personalization.
Simple ideas include crafting your own centerpieces using flowers, candles, or glass jars. Handmade signage, photo displays, and guest books can also enhance the ambiance without a hefty price tag.
Enlist the help of friends and family for DIY projects, turning the crafting into a fun pre-wedding activity. Remember, the internet is filled with tutorials and inspiration to help you create stunning decor that reflects your style and theme.
Affordable Bridal Accessories
Accessories complete a bride's look, and there are plenty of budget-friendly options available. Consider borrowing heirloom pieces from family or friends for that "something borrowed" tradition.
Costume jewelry can mimic the look of more expensive pieces without the high price. Many online retailers offer beautiful, affordable veils, shoes, and hairpieces, allowing you to complete your ensemble economically.
Remember, the key is to find accessories that complement your gown and personal style without overshadowing them. A well-chosen accessory can add elegance and sophistication to your wedding attire.
Is Catering Cost-Effective?
Catering is another significant expense, but it doesn't have to break the bank. Consider buffet-style meals or family-style service, which can be less expensive than plated dinners. Offering a limited menu with fewer options can also reduce costs.
Some couples choose to have a potluck-style reception, where guests contribute dishes, adding a personal and communal touch. Alternatively, hiring a food truck or a local restaurant can provide a unique and affordable dining experience.
Don't forget to ask about discounts for children or vendors and consider serving a small cake alongside a dessert buffet, reducing the cost of a large wedding cake.
Wedding Invites That Won’t Break the Bank
Wedding invitations are the first glimpse your guests get of your wedding theme, but they don't need to be expensive. Consider using digital invitations, which are eco-friendly and cost-effective.
If you prefer traditional printed invites, look for online companies offering customizable templates at affordable prices. DIY invitations can also be a creative and budget-friendly option.
Remember, simple designs with quality paper can look just as elegant as more elaborate, costly options. The key is to convey your theme and personality without overspending.
Capturing Memories on a Budget
Photography and videography are crucial for capturing the memories of your big day, but they can also be pricey. To save, consider hiring a talented amateur photographer or a student looking to build their portfolio.
Some couples opt for a shorter photography package that covers only the key moments of the day. Alternatively, set up a photo booth with props for guests to take their own pictures, creating a fun and interactive experience.
Look for photographers who offer digital packages rather than printed albums, allowing you to print only the photos you love most. Remember, your memories are priceless, but capturing them doesn't have to be costly.
Music and Entertainment
Music and entertainment set the mood for your wedding reception, but they don't have to be budget-busters. Consider hiring a DJ instead of a live band, or create a playlist of your favorite songs to play through a sound system.
For a unique touch, hire local musicians or performers, who may charge less than larger or more established acts. Interactive entertainment, such as a magician or caricature artist, can also add a memorable element without a hefty price tag.
Remember, the key is to keep your guests engaged and entertained, creating an atmosphere that reflects your personality and style.
Are Destination Weddings Affordable?
Destination weddings can seem costly, but they can also be an affordable option if planned carefully. Many resorts offer all-inclusive packages that cover accommodations, meals, and wedding services, simplifying the planning process and reducing costs.
By combining the wedding and honeymoon in one location, couples can save significantly. Additionally, destination weddings often have smaller guest lists, reducing expenses for food and drink.
Consider off-season travel to popular destinations, as this can lead to substantial savings on flights and accommodations. Remember, a destination wedding can be both a memorable and affordable experience with the right planning.
Transportation Tips
Transportation is an essential part of wedding logistics, but there are ways to keep costs down. Renting a single vehicle for the bridal party can be more economical than multiple cars.
Consider using ride-sharing services for guests, or arrange a shuttle bus to transport everyone from the ceremony to the reception. If the venues are close, encourage guests to walk, adding a charming and relaxed vibe to the day.
Remember, transportation doesn't have to be extravagant; it's more important to ensure everyone arrives safely and on time.
How to Manage Your Guest List Efficiently?
The size of your guest list significantly impacts your wedding budget, so it's essential to manage it efficiently. Start by determining your must-invite list, including close family and friends, and then expand to include additional guests if budget allows.
Consider inviting fewer people to the ceremony and more to the reception or hosting a smaller, more intimate wedding followed by a larger celebration. Remember, the key is to prioritize those who matter most, creating a meaningful and memorable day.
Wedding Favors on a Dime
Wedding favors are a nice way to thank your guests, but they don't need to be expensive. Consider DIY favors like homemade jams, candles, or baked goods, which add a personal touch.
Simple and thoughtful favors, such as a small plant or a charitable donation in guests' names, can be both affordable and appreciated. Remember, the gesture is more important than the cost, so choose favors that reflect your personality and gratitude.
Honeymoon on a Budget
A honeymoon is a chance to relax and celebrate your new life together, but it doesn't have to be extravagant. Consider staying closer to home or choosing a less touristy destination, which can offer both savings and unique experiences.
Look for travel deals, off-season discounts, and package offers that include flights, accommodations, and activities. Alternatively, plan a short mini-moon close to home, with the option to take a longer trip later when finances allow.
Remember, the key is to create lasting memories and enjoy each other's company, regardless of the destination.
How to Find the Best Bridal Deals?
Finding the best bridal deals requires research, patience, and a willingness to negotiate. Start by comparing prices and services from different vendors, and don't be afraid to ask for discounts or special offers.
Sign up for newsletters and follow wedding-related social media accounts for updates on sales and promotions. Consider attending bridal fairs or expos, which often feature exclusive deals and giveaways.
Remember, the key is to stay flexible and open-minded, allowing you to find the best deals without compromising on quality or style.
